About Barangay Salcedo

Classified as a mid-sized barangay, Barangay Salcedo is one of the administrative divisions of San Manuel in Tarlac, Central Luzon, Philippines.

According to the 2020 Census of Population and Housing conducted by the Philippine Statistics Authority, Barangay Salcedo had a population of 2,420. This made it the 4th largest of 15 barangays in San Manuel by population, placing it in the upper half of the municipality. Residents of Barangay Salcedo accounted for approximately 8.53% of the total population of San Manuel, which stood at 28,387 in the same census year.

Between the 2015 and 2020 censuses, the population of Barangay Salcedo changed from 2,368 to 2,420, a shift of +2.2% over the five-year period. This places the barangay among those with growing populations in San Manuel. The Philippine Statistics Authority classifies Barangay Salcedo as rural, a designation applied to barangays with lower population density and predominantly non-built-up land use.

San Manuel is a municipality comprising 15 barangays, and serves as the governing unit directly responsible for local services in Barangay Salcedo, including public health, sanitation, peace and order, and civil registration. Within the wider province of Tarlac, which contains 511 barangays across its component cities and municipalities, Barangay Salcedo ranks 207th by 2020 population. Tarlac is classified as a 1st by the Bureau of Local Government Finance, a category that reflects the province's annual regular income.

The barangay's legislative and executive affairs are handled by a Punong Barangay and the Sangguniang Barangay, elected nationwide during the Barangay and SK Elections. The next BSKE is scheduled for Monday, November 2, 2026, following the synchronized election schedule set by COMELEC Resolution No. 11191.
